Monetary Judgments. One or more judgments, non-interlocutory orders, decrees or arbitration awards shall be entered against any one or more of the Credit Parties or any of their respective Subsidiaries involving in the aggregate a liability of $2,200,000 or more (excluding amounts covered by either (i) insurance to the extent the relevant independent third-party insurer has not denied coverage therefor or (ii) an indemnification agreement as to which the indemnifying party has not denied liability), and the same shall remain unsatisfied, unvacated and unstayed pending appeal for a period of thirty (30) days after the entry thereof; or
